Managing Japan import tax and customs duties for cosmetics
Understanding the import tax regulations in Japan is essential for a smooth delivery. For personal imports, if the total value of your shipment (including shipping costs) is under ¥16,666, you are generally exempt from consumption tax and customs duties. The Rhode Summer Lip Tint Set typically falls under this threshold if purchased individually.
However, if you are package forwarding multiple sets or high-value items, be aware that cosmetics are subject to specific quantity restrictions in Japan. Individuals are usually permitted to import up to 24 pieces of a single cosmetic item for personal use. Exceeding this limit can lead to delays at customs or require additional documentation. Always verify your total shipment value to keep your international shipping service costs predictable and avoid unexpected fees upon arrival.
